This article reports that the Mulberry cogeneration facility has several features that make it notable in the power field. A zero-discharge wastewater system, an inlet-air chilling system, a secondary boiler, and an extensive distributed-control system (DCS) for overall plant operation are examples. Ability to meet the two-stage NO{sub x}-emission limits -- 25 ppm during the first three years and 15 ppm thereafter -- is a unique challenge. The plant design allows the lower limit to be met now, and retrofit with different burners is possible if NO{sub x}-emission limits are tightened later. The facility, near Bartow in Polk County, Fla, is owned by Polk Power Partners LP, whose members include Central and South West Energy Inc (CSW) of Dallas and ARK Energy of Laguna Hills, Calif. The operating company, CSW Operations, is a subsidiary of CSW. Heart of the plant is a single gas-turbine (GT)/HRSG/steam-turbine combined cycle, providing electric power to Tampa Electric Co and Florida Power Corp, with up to 25,000 lb/hr of process steam for an adjacent ethanol plant which was developed by the facility`s partnership. Commercial operation of Mulberry began on Sept 2, 1994.
